Colacium simplex is a photosynthetic euglenoid protist in the family Euglenaceae, notable for its epibiotic lifestyle as a stalked organism colonizing the surfaces of freshwater crustaceans and other zooplankton. This microscopic species belongs to a genus that bridges free-swimming euglenoid behavior and sessile, colonial existence, attaching to hosts via mucilaginous stalks. Colacium simplex, as its name implies, exhibits a relatively uncomplicated morphology compared to other genus members, with simple colony structures that anchor to copepods, cladocerans, and occasionally other small invertebrates. The organism photosynthesizes when light is available, using chloroplasts derived from the green algal endosymbiont common to euglenoids, while potentially employing osmotrophic nutrition in darker conditions. Its presence on zooplankton hosts can affect host swimming behavior and, in heavy infestations, may impose a metabolic cost on the carrier. Colacium simplex inhabits lentic and slow-moving lotic freshwater systems globally, wherever appropriate zooplankton hosts occur. It plays a role in microbial community structure and organic matter dynamics in planktonic food webs. Taxonomic understanding of the genus continues to evolve with molecular phylogenetic studies.
